From: Peter Palfrader <peter@palfrader.org>
Date: Tue, 28 May 2013 19:30:28 +0000 (+0200)
Subject: remove apt/perferences.d/buildd on all hosts
X-Git-Url: https://git.donarmstrong.com/?a=commitdiff_plain;h=dceca389ae68f061652fc303e066bdb3e9d23aa6;p=dsa-puppet.git

remove apt/perferences.d/buildd on all hosts
---

diff --git a/modules/buildd/manifests/init.pp b/modules/buildd/manifests/init.pp
index e0a5ad83..2dff5ec5 100644
--- a/modules/buildd/manifests/init.pp
+++ b/modules/buildd/manifests/init.pp
@@ -73,8 +73,7 @@ class buildd ($ensure=present) {
 		ensure => absent,
 	}
 	file { '/etc/apt/preferences.d/buildd':
-		content => template('buildd/etc/apt/preferences.d/buildd'),
-		before  => Site::Aptrepo['buildd.debian.org']
+		ensure => absent,
 	}
 	file { '/etc/cron.d/dsa-buildd':
 		source  => 'puppet:///modules/buildd/cron.d-dsa-buildd',
diff --git a/modules/buildd/templates/etc/apt/preferences.d/buildd b/modules/buildd/templates/etc/apt/preferences.d/buildd
deleted file mode 100644
index 4be1d8ea..00000000
--- a/modules/buildd/templates/etc/apt/preferences.d/buildd
+++ /dev/null
@@ -1,17 +0,0 @@
-<% if scope.lookupvar('site::nodeinfo')['ldap'].has_key?('architecture') and scope.lookupvar('site::nodeinfo')['ldap']['architecture'][0] == 'armhf' -%>
-Package: schroot
-Pin: release o=buildd.debian.org
-Pin-Priority: 700
-
-Package: schroot-common
-Pin: release o=buildd.debian.org
-Pin-Priority: 700
-<% else -%>
-Package: schroot
-Pin: release o=buildd.debian.org
-Pin-Priority: 500
-
-Package: schroot-common
-Pin: release o=buildd.debian.org
-Pin-Priority: 500
-<% end %>